Transaction 33b113a1e50c43ffdb65e0526fac20bc92f162374829ee1ee8157a57e921ac94

3 Input
1 Outputs
  • 33b113a1e50c43ffdb65e0526fac20bc92f162374829ee1ee8157a57e921ac94:0
  • value  50242902
    address  1MRiUKFWa7G4vS285ABPoBJtRuTpBrkBH6